  1. Is there any way i can play a dvd on my pc without having a computer dvd player (DVD-R/RW)?

    But! no you can not play a DVD on any computer with out a proper DVD-ROM, or DVD-R(W){RAM} drive. This is only because normal cds info is written farther apart than dvd info, which is closer togther. Only dvd lasers can pick this up, and cd laser can not

  4. Actually you can if you have a standalone player, and just put the composites to your video card and audio card(if your video card and audio card have them). This is probably a stupid reply because if you don't have a dvd-rom, then the odds are you don't have a video card with composite or s-video inputs!!
